Output 53d2900fb1fcc41422f6899da7d9a2661fa2ab910425f4dfeee83cfa916509ce:1

value
474775
script pubkey
OP_HASH160 OP_PUSHBYTES_20 de928380d52162762270328eb2309db9118561a5 OP_EQUAL
address
3MysT5ZHFkm39RUYtWgG7Kjzvtpydx3b7s
transaction
53d2900fb1fcc41422f6899da7d9a2661fa2ab910425f4dfeee83cfa916509ce
confirmations
177183
spent
true